Human Remains Found Near Rock Island Dam
Since February 6th of this year, the CCSO and other agencies have been searching for leads into the disappearance of 18-year-old Erik Luna. Last seen around 6 PM in Bridgeport on that day, his family said his vanishing, and not contacting them, was very out of character.

Now this week, the CCSO say human remains found in the Columbia River near Rock Island Dam are not that of Luna. They did not say how they reached that conclusion.
Authorities didn’t say how long the remains had been in the water, but the said they are not of the missing teen. The Department was notified about the discovery shortly before 8 PM on Monday, the 20th.
The Coroner and Other Officials Working to ID the Person
The CCSO said tests are being conducted to try to determine the ID of the remains taken out of the water, the investigation into both cases continues. Bridgeport is about 69 miles north of Wenatchee, and 81 miles north of the Rock Island Dam.
